> # 2. What are DTD's?
> 
> DTD is short for Data Type Definition.  It defaults the structure of your
> XML document.  Remember XML is a meta-language, and your own tags comprise
> your langage.  The DTD defines what are the legal elements in your
> language.
> 
> Also, the DTD is used by validating XML parsers to validate if the XML
> elements (or data) adhere to the format.

> # 4. What are RSS and WML?
> # 
> 
> Dunno much about RSS, but WML is the mark-up language used for WAP-enabled
> devices.  WMLs files are basically XML documents that adhere to the WML
> DTD -- you can only put tags allowable to WML (which is declared in the
> DTD).
